Ayala Obtains Full Defense Judgment in Million-Dollar Multi-Family Real Estate Dispute Trial

By October 18, 2024October 22nd, 2024No Comments

Ayala is proud to announce that it has obtained a full defense judgment in a real estate dispute over the payment of a $500,000 loan collateralized by a Miami multifamily building now worth over $1 million.

The complaint alleged that Ayala’s client, the defendant, unlawfully transferred the propertyโ€™s title (jointly owned by the parties) to a company co-owned by both.

The complaint in the case included claims of Civil Theft, Conspiracy, Quiet Title, and Slander of Title, among others.

Ayalaโ€™s client stated in his defense that the plaintiff had previously signed documents transferring the property to a trust (including a power of attorney), where she clearly authorized the defendant to carry out such transfers.

At trial, Ayalaโ€™s client testified that the transfer was not done for fraudulent purposes, as claimed in the complaint, but rather to protect the creditor who had lent the money to purchase the asset in question, and who was also a longtime friend of both the plaintiff and the defendant.

In the end, the court sided with Ayalaโ€™s client, ruling, among other findings, that:

โ€œPlaintiff ha[d] failed to meet its burden of proof on all the Counts pleaded and tried before the Court. The documents executed are declared valid and support authority for the transfers that occurred.โ€

Attorney Eduardo A. Maura and Orestes Garcia tried the case.ย As Eduardo A. Maura stated, “We are very pleased with the outcome. The court recognized that our client acted legally, that the transfer was legitimate based on validly executed documents, and that it was done to protect a debt. Our client never made a penny out of this.โ€
